Pusat Perdagangan One in Petaling, Selangor recorded 5 subsale transactions in 2024, with a median price of RM 3.30 million and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 482.

This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 3.30 million,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 2.28 million to RM 4.32 million, and a typical market range of RM 2.55 million to RM 4.06 million.

Most transactions involved 3 - 3 1/2 storey shop, with high diversity across multiple property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 482, with most transactions between RM 447 and RM 518.
